Update: 01.17.2008
v1.01 Added the ability to round to a specific number of decimal places or stop. This was a huge hit at work as it takes the place of an adding machine tape and has alot more detail if needed.

I'm a noob ahk recruit. I'm absolutely loving this program. It is therapeutic and honestly is leading to tremendous time savings for me. While in the process of writing a suite of scripts to help me do a wide variety of things I added a calculator. It is based loosely on my favorite calculator that sadly will not work on Vista.
(Not that i've changed to Vista yet but it will happen eventually I fear...)
Anyway, please try it out and make suggestions. If you like it please let me know!

Hey mikronos, please download the updated version that is linked to above. Someone at work had noticed the same thing. I had added a function to delete trailing zeroes as the math function did not. I had ordered the script incorrectly and so it was deleting significant zeroes also. It has been fixed now.

Gui, 2:Add, Text, +xm +ys+295 w900, Note: Basic Operators: Add: +, Subtract: -, Multiply: *, Divide: /, Exponent **`n`nAbs(Number): Returns the absolute value of Number. The return value is the same type as Number (integer or floating point).`n`nCeil(Number): Returns Number rounded up to the nearest integer (without any .00 suffix). For example, Ceil(1.2) is 2 and Ceil(-1.2) is -1.Exp(N): Returns e (which is approximately 2.71828182845905) raised to the Nth power. N may be negative and may contain a decimal point. To raise numbers other than e to a power, use the ** operator.`n`nFloor(Number): Returns Number rounded down to the nearest integer (without any .00 suffix). For example, Floor(1.2) is 1 and Floor(-1.2) is -2.`n`nLog(Number): Returns the logarithm (base 10) of Number. The result is formatted as floating point. If Number is negative, an empty string is returned.`n`nLn(Number): Returns the natural logarithm (base e) of Number. The result is formatted as floating point. If Number is negative, an empty string is returned.`n`nMod(Dividend, Divisor): Modulo. Returns the remainder when Dividend is divided by Divisor. The sign of the result is always the same as the sign of the first parameter. For example, both mod(5, 3)and mod(5, -3) yield 2, but mod(-5, 3) and mod(-5, -3) yield -2. If either input is a floating point number, the result is also a floating point number. For example, mod(5.0, 3) is 2.0 and mod(5, 3.5) is 1.5. If the second parameter is zero, the function yields a blank result (empty string).`n`nRound(Number [, N]): If N is omitted or 0, Number is rounded to the nearest integer. If N is positive number, Number is rounded to N decimal places. If N is negative, Number is rounded by N digits to the leftof the decimal point. For example, Round(345, -1) is 350 and Round (345, -2) is 300. Unlike Transform Round, the result has no .000 suffix whenever N is omitted or less than 1. In v1.0.44.01+, a value of N greater than zero displays exactly N decimal places rather than obeying SetFormat. To avoid this, perform another math operation on Round()'s return value; for example: Round(3.333, 1)+0.`n`nSqrt(Number): Returns the square root of Number. The result is formatted as floating point. If Number is negative, the function yields a blank result (empty string).

Gui, 2:Add, Text, +xm +ys+15 w900, Sin(Number) | Cos(Number) | Tan(Number) : Returns the trigonometric sine|cosine|tangent of Number. Number must be expressed in radians.`n`nASin(Number): Returns the arcsine (the number whose sine is Number) in radians. If Number is less than -1 or greater than 1, the function yields a blank result (empty string).`n`nACos(Number): Returns the arccosine (the number whose cosine is Number) in radians. If Number is less than -1 or greater than 1, the function yields a blank result (empty string).`n`nATan(Number): Returns the arctangent (the number whose tangent is Number) in radians.`n`nNote: To convert a radians value to degrees, multiply it by 180/pi (approximately 57.29578). To convert a degrees value to radians, multiply it by pi/180 (approximately 0.01745329252). The value of pi (approximately 3.141592653589793) is 4 times the arctangent of 1.`n
